Fluid For Amylase

Also Known As: Fluid for Amy
The Fluid for Amylase test measures the level of amylase enzyme in fluids collected from body cavities—most commonly in Ascitic fluid (abdominal fluid), Pleural fluid (around the lungs), Peritoneal fluid, Pericardial fluid. Amylase in body fluids helps identify pancreatic disorders, gastrointestinal perforations, and certain infections or malignancies. It detects increased levels of amylase in fluids like pleural fluid in cases of Acute pancreatitis and Pancreatic pseudocyst. It may also be elvated in cases of Peptic ulcer and Mesenteric vascular occlusion.
